- RRobertCoastal Georgia •1 review5.0Dined 4 days agoMy girlfriend and I recently dined at Garibaldi’s Cafe in Savannah, and it was an unforgettable experience. We started with the lamb ribs as an appetizer, which were tender, flavorful, and perfectly seasoned—a delightful way to begin our meal. For my entrée, I chose the seafood Alfredo. The pasta was cooked to perfection, and the seafood was fresh and abundant, all enveloped in a rich and creamy Alfredo sauce. It was truly a 5/5 dish that I would highly recommend to anyone visiting. The ambiance of the restaurant was both elegant and inviting, creating a perfect setting for a memorable evening. The service was attentive and professional, enhancing our overall dining experience. If you’re in Savannah and looking for a top-notch dining experience, Garibaldi’s Cafe is a must-visit. - TTheresaAtlanta •6 reviews5.0Dined 4 days agoIt was my first time in Savannah, and although a reservation for dinner on Valentine’s Day was unavailable, we were able to get one for the night before in early evening. When we found the table for two to be quite small, we were quickly and pleasantly moved to a table for four. Drinks were the Savannah Peach (smooth and not too strong). Our dinner included French onion soup, grouper, crab cakes, and sides. Dessert (excellent choices) was chocolate mousse cake and the Peach Trio. The entire meal was absolutely delicious. Our server was attentive, accommodating, informative and not at all intrusive. Over all, a wonderful experience for a special, romantic long weekend. Our only regret - we wanted to return for dinner on Saturday evening, but there were no tables available.
